| Has Hadith Text | Narrated Hudhaifa: Once Umar Bin AlKhattab … Narrated Hudhaifa: Once Umar Bin AlKhattab said; said; Who amongst you remembers the statement of Allah Apostle regarding the afflictions? Hudhaifa replied; I remember what he said exactly. Umar said. Tell us ; you are really a daring man! Hudhaifa said; Allah Messenger ﷺ said; A man afflictions i.e. wrong deeds concerning his relation to his family; his property and his neighbors are expiated by his prayers; giving in charity and enjoining what is good and forbidding what is evil. Umar said; I dont mean these afflictions but the afflictions that will be heaving up and down like waves of the sea. Hudhaifa replied; O chief of the believers! You need not fear those afflictions as there is a closed door between you and them. Umar asked; Will that door be opened or broken? Hudhaifa replied; No; it will be broken. Umar said; Then it is very likely that the door will not be closed again. Later on the people asked Hudhaifa; Did Umar know what that door meant? He said. Yes; Umar knew it as everyone knows that there will be night before the tomorrow morning. I narrated to Umar an authentic narration; not lies.
